///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
53
// Convert the 3D point3D into a 2D point on the same face surface, but in a different
54
// coordinate system: a in-plane 2D coord where the origin is in the point where the axis intersects
55
// the surface, and whose Y axis points 'north' i.e. is in the plane given by the 3D origin, the
56
// original 3D Y axis and our 2D in-plane origin.
57
// If those 3 points constitute a degenerate triangle which does not define a plane - which can only
58
// happen if axis is vertical (or in theory when 2D origin and 3D origin meet, but that would have to
59
// mean that the distance between the center of the Object and its faces is 0) - then we arbitrarily
60
// decide that 2D Y = (0,0,-1) in the North Pole and (0,0,1) in the South Pole)
61
// (ax,ay,az) - vector normal to the face surface.
62
63
  void convertTo2Dcoords(float[] point3D, float ax, float ay, float az , float[] output)
64
    {
65
    float y0,y1,y2; // base Y vector of the 2D coord system
66
67
    if( ax==0.0f && az==0.0f )
68
      {
69
      y0=0; y1=0; y2=-ay;
70
      }
71
    else if( ay==0.0f )
72
      {
73
      y0=0; y1=1; y2=0;
74
      }
75
    else
76
      {
77
      float norm = (float)(-ay/Math.sqrt(1-ay*ay));
78
      y0 = norm*ax; y1= norm*(ay-1/ay); y2=norm*az;
79
      }
80
81
    float x0 = y1*az - y2*ay;  //
82
    float x1 = y2*ax - y0*az;  // (2D coord baseY) x (axis) = 2D coord baseX
83
    float x2 = y0*ay - y1*ax;  //
84
85
    float originAlpha = point3D[0]*ax + point3D[1]*ay + point3D[2]*az;
86
87
    float origin0 = originAlpha*ax; // coords of the point where axis
88
    float origin1 = originAlpha*ay; // intersects surface plane i.e.
89
    float origin2 = originAlpha*az; // the origin of our 2D coord system
90
91
    float v0 = point3D[0] - origin0;
92
    float v1 = point3D[1] - origin1;
93
    float v2 = point3D[2] - origin2;
94
95
    output[0] = v0*x0 + v1*x1 + v2*x2;
96
    output[1] = v0*y0 + v1*y1 + v2*y2;
97
    }

///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
100
// given precomputed mCamera and mPoint, respectively camera and touch point positions in ScreenSpace,
101
// compute point 'output[]' which:
102
// 1) lies on a face of the Object, i.e. surface defined by (axis, distance from (0,0,0))
103
// 2) is co-linear with mCamera and mPoint
104
//
105
// output = camera + alpha*(point-camera), where alpha = [dist-axis*camera] / [axis*(point-camera)]
106
107 213c15de Leszek Koltunski
  private void castTouchPointOntoFace(int face, float[] output)
108 903041cd Leszek Koltunski
    {
109 213c15de Leszek Koltunski
    Static3D faceAxis = mFaceAxis[face];
110 903041cd Leszek Koltunski
111
    float d0 = mPoint[0]-mCamera[0];
112
    float d1 = mPoint[1]-mCamera[1];
113
    float d2 = mPoint[2]-mCamera[2];
114
    float a0 = faceAxis.get0();
115
    float a1 = faceAxis.get1();
116
    float a2 = faceAxis.get2();
117
118
    float denom = a0*d0 + a1*d1 + a2*d2;
119
120
    if( denom != 0.0f )
121
      {
122
      float axisCam = a0*mCamera[0] + a1*mCamera[1] + a2*mCamera[2];
123 213c15de Leszek Koltunski
      float alpha = (mDist3D[face]-axisCam)/denom;
124 903041cd Leszek Koltunski
125
      output[0] = mCamera[0] + d0*alpha;
126
      output[1] = mCamera[1] + d1*alpha;
127
      output[2] = mCamera[2] + d2*alpha;
128
      }
129
    }
